Is it any wonder that a guy who spent his childhood fabricating everything from Lego sculptures to rebuilt automobiles would grow up to own a company known for creating the world’s largest Miller Lite bottle?
It doesn’t surprise Shad Bruce a bit.
“I was always creative as a child,” said Bruce, who owns Detail Design & Fabrication, a Tempe business that designs and constructs indoor/outdoor signage, three-dimensional displays and trade-show exhibits for clients including Westcor, Phoenix International Raceway and the Arizona Diamondbacks. “I was always building things. I started with Legos and worked my way up to skateboards, bikes and cars. That was my early fabrication experience.”
Bruce earned an industrial design degree from Arizona State University’s School of Architecture & Landscape Architecture and launched DD&F in 1998 to provide design, fabrication and installation services under one roof. His work with the Diamondbacks includes the fully branded head-to-toe makeover of Chase Field with the team’s new color scheme — not to mention the design, construction and installation of a 36-foot-tall, three-dimensional Miller Lite bottle, which debuted at the ballpark this spring to trumpet Diamond Club sponsor Miller Brewing Co.
